En este artículo
Por que importa comparar texto y codigo
Encontrar diferencias entre dos versiones de un archivo es una de las tareas mas comunes en el desarrollo de software, la edicion de contenido y la administracion de sistemas. Ya sea que estes revisando un pull request, rastreando cambios en un archivo de configuracion o comparando respuestas de API antes y despues de un despliegue, una herramienta de diferencias confiable te muestra exactamente que cambio, que se agrego y que se elimino.
La comparacion manual es propensa a errores y tediosa, especialmente para archivos grandes. Una sola coma mal colocada en una configuracion JSON o un cambio sutil de redaccion en un documento legal puede pasar desapercibido durante un escaneo visual. Un comparador de diferencias automatizado resalta cada diferencia al instante, dandote la confianza de que nada se paso por alto.
Como usar el comparador de diferencias
El comparador de diferencias de CheckTown compara dos bloques de texto lado a lado y resalta cada insercion, eliminacion y modificacion a nivel de linea o caracter.
- Pega tu texto original en el panel izquierdo y el texto modificado en el panel derecho — la comparacion se ejecuta instantaneamente mientras escribes
- Las lineas agregadas se resaltan en verde y las eliminadas en rojo, con resaltados en linea a nivel de caracter que muestran exactamente que partes de una linea cambiaron
- Alterna entre modos de vista unificada y dividida segun prefieras una diferencia compacta en una sola columna o una comparacion lado a lado
- Usa el control de ignorar espacios en blanco para filtrar los cambios de indentacion cuando solo te interesan las diferencias de contenido significativas
Pruébalo gratis — sin registro
Comparar texto ahora →Consejos para una comparacion de texto efectiva
Aprovechar al maximo una herramienta de diferencias requiere algunas practicas simples que reducen el ruido y destacan los cambios que realmente importan.
- Normaliza el formato antes de comparar — la indentacion y los finales de linea consistentes evitan que cientos de diferencias de falsos positivos abarroten la salida
- Usa la opcion de ignorar espacios en blanco para revisiones de codigo donde los cambios de estilo estan separados de los cambios de logica — esto te permite enfocarte en las modificaciones funcionales
- Para documentos grandes, escanea primero el conteo resumen de adiciones y eliminaciones para evaluar el alcance de los cambios antes de sumergirte en las lineas individuales
Preguntas frecuentes
El comparador de diferencias soporta carga de archivos?
El comparador de diferencias funciona con texto pegado. Para comparaciones basadas en archivos, copia el contenido de cada archivo en los paneles izquierdo y derecho. Este enfoque funciona con cualquier formato de texto incluyendo codigo, archivos de configuracion, datos CSV y texto normal.
Cual es la diferencia entre vista unificada y dividida?
La vista unificada muestra ambas versiones en una sola columna con adiciones y eliminaciones intercaladas, similar a la salida de git diff. La vista dividida coloca el texto original y el modificado lado a lado para que puedas desplazarte por ambos simultaneamente. Elige la vista unificada para una revision compacta y la dividida para una comparacion detallada linea por linea.
Puedo comparar JSON o datos estructurados?
Si. El comparador de diferencias trata toda la entrada como texto, asi que funciona con JSON, YAML, XML, SQL o cualquier otro formato estructurado. Para JSON especificamente, considera formatear ambas entradas con el formateador de JSON de CheckTown primero para que las diferencias estructurales no queden ocultas por indentacion inconsistente.